    I downloaded the animation pack from here:
    https://www.assetstore.unity3d.com/en/#!/content/25794
    The assert contains a fbx file, which contains a bunch of animations.

    Then in Animator window I added a State and transitions between states and have set the Motion in the inspector of the state.
    Then I look at the preview in Animator's inspector with it original Model, the animation works properly:
    Original.PNG

    If I apply Unity Model or my custom Model, its became:
    Weird.PNG

    Why is that? How can I fix it?
    Or did I use it incorrectly?

    I just notice the animation package Model is set as Generic, in order to match the Unity Model its has to set as humanoid as well.
    Now is working perfectly fine!
